The ARCTIC F12 PWM PST CO is a high-performance 120 mm case fan designed for optimal airflow and minimal noise. With a fan speed range of 230-1350 RPM, it features innovative PWM Sharing Technology (PST) for synchronized fan control, ensuring efficient cooling tailored to your system's needs. The premium Japanese dual ball bearing design guarantees continuous operation, making it a reliable choice for any computer setup.

120mm Ball bearing PWM fans

Very impressive fans for the price. Great volume of air for their size for a respectably low noise tradeoff. I bought eight of these (Obsidian 900d case) for my new build and they're hardly audible. Granted, all are on my motherboard's PWM signal so they stay at a low duty cycle most of the time. However, even during P95 on three cores plus Furmark running (GPU is watercooled as well) they have no problem keeping things cool. I specifically wanted a ball bearing fan because three are mounted horizontally in the case roof on a 360mm radiator. Ball bearing fans are much better suited to this mounting position than journal bearing fans.

Great value!

Bought two of them to replace case fans on an Antec Fusion Black case (htpc kind). Those are not bad fans (have a switch with 3 levels of cooling and the lowest one is nearly silent) but I wanted to go PWM, to see if I could improve the acoustics even more.At full speed (1400RPM aprox.), these are definitely NOT quiet...they sound like a jet fighter to be completely honest. Totally unwanted on a HTPC scenario. Blades look sharp-edged...I`m not an engineer of any kind but, wouldn't thicker softer-edged blades improve on the accoustics?Taking them to 1000RPM via PWM, would leave you with a much more pleasant situation, but it's just nearly matching the Antecs included in the case.The sweet spot is taking them to the 700, 800 RPM speeds...doing that (and doing something similar with a CPU solution like the Artic Alpine 64 Plus) will grant you with a dead silent HTPC (almost, unless you stand really close to the case). Don't expect huge amounts of air moving at those speeds though. Nevertheless, my htpc CPU stays at 27 ºC and motherboard at 37º C (with these F12 fans and the above mentioned Artic CPU heatsink/fan)..On the hand, if you don't care about noise and would leave them work at full speed, you are assured a great deal of air movement.A nice innovating feature from Artic in these, is PWM Sharing Technology (PST), which gives one the possibility to "daisy chain" fans, for instance: case-fan to case-fan, and those two to your CPU one. That would be a great plus for someone with a single available PWM controlled case/cpu fan header.All in all, they are very good fans and would certainly recommend them. There may be even quieter ones (you name them), but for the price point they are fierce contenders.

Best quality fans

These fans are not only quiet, they still move a good amount of air. 4-pin PWM control lets you run them down to well under 25% speed to make them silent if needed.They are good for large aftermarket CPU coolers and as case fans, especially when paired with newer motherboards and their proliferation of 4-pin fan connectors. My good-ol' Antec P180 now has 4 of these, with one more on my Thermalright CPU cooler.The ability to 'share' the PWM signal to other 4-pin fans is great for stacking a case inlet fan with your CPU as well.I'm also using one with a custom temperature monitoring circuit to cool my receiver and amplifiers in my home theater setup as well.
